SLIMY STUFF: Barbados beaches hit with pungent seaweed 18 JUN 014: Clean-up crews in tourism-dependent Barbados are trying to clear gobs of pungent brown sargassum seaweed that is littering numerous beaches. The slimy brown stuff is washing ashore at beaches from Barbados north to south coasts. The government said Tuesday it is welcoming assistance from schools and community groups to clear the seaweed. Sargassum is an algae that grows in the Sargasso Sea, a large body of warm water in the mid-Atlantic. Ricardo Marshall is a projects officer with the Caribbean islands National Conservation Commission. He says crews are being deployed daily to clear coastlines of piles of sargassum seaweed. Officials in nearby Caribbean islands are warning about the possibility of ample amounts of seaweed washing ashore.
